Lopez, Sylviane. "Transformation de l'activité d'apprenants de l'enseignement professionnel en situation de presque accident : une approche énactive". Electronic Thesis or Diss., Université de Toulouse (2023-....), 2024. http://www.theses.fr/2024TLSEJ014.
The thesis entitled « Transformation of vocational learners’ activities in near-accident situations An enactive approach » focuses on the imperative of preventing accidents among learners in agricultural education during their professional training period in companies. The goal is to explore learner activity in risky professional situations, with particular attention to the population of young workers. It aims to decipher their behaviors and attitudes in potentially dangerous situations and identify variables influencing their decision-making processes, thereby enhancing understanding of issues related to occupational health and safety (OHS). Themethodology adopted relies on the intersection of Vermersch’s psychophenomenology Vermersch, 2012; Depraz et al., 2011) and the explicitation interview, combined with the Empirical Research Program of Course of Action within the enactive paradigm proposed by Theureau (2004a, 2015). This theoretical combination enables the analysis of learners’ work ituations in near-accident scenarios, which refer to situations that could have resulted in an accident. This qualitative and heuristic study comprises 11 case studies : five interviews with apprentices in Apprenticeship Training Centers, three with students in Rural Family Houses, and three with students in initial training in agricultural high schools. The aim is to describe, through xplicitation interviews, the lived experience during near-accident situations, without making prior assumptions about the learning process, and to identify factors that have facilitated or indered the learners’ protection. In this perspective, the primary objective is to capture the subjective experience of learners in order to understand how their activity transforms during this specific moment, referred to as the « moment of reversal » (t = r ). The analysis of « courses of experience » allows for understanding the factors that led to the incident, shedding light on the transformations of the activity. The results of this research reveal the intentional ambivalence of learners, manifested by their dual intention to meet social and personal expectations while taking risks to demonstrate their competence. Various fundamental concerns influence the transformation of young individuals’ activity during their decision-making processes, including contrasting emotions ranging from confidence to incomprehension, as well as feelings of pride and anger towards oneself, disappointment, and fear. Furthermore, a strong determination to fully engage in tasks, to succeed, to avoid delays and meet deadlines, a particular attention to details and landmarks, such as lunchtime, and anticipation of tasksto be accomplished, quick and effective reactions to unexpected or dangerous situations (sometimes surprising), and a pronounced self-critique and sense of guilt in case of failure. These results suggest potential implications for accident prevention and improvement in the pproach to health and safety at work among learners. The thesis emphasizes the necessity for actors involved in learner training during their work placements to consider the levels of leaning and contextual dimensions relevant to the learner
